Persistent Viral Infections Edited by Rafi Ahmed Emory Vaccine Center, Atlanta, USA and Irvin S. Y. Chen UCLA School of Medicine, Los Angeles, USA During the past decade much of our attention has focused on diseases associated with viral persistence. Major breakthroughs in immunology, and the advent of molecular approaches to study pathogenesis have increased our understanding of the complex virus–host interactions that occur during viral persistence. Persistent Viral Infections focuses on:
∗ The pathogenesis and immunology of chronic infections
∗ Animal models that provide, or have the potential to provide, major insights
This volume will be essential reading for virologists, immunologists, oncologists and neurologists.
